Securing a Vue.js app using OpenID Connect Code Flow with PKCE and IdentityServer4

This article shows how to setup a Vue.js SPA application to authenticate and authorize using OpenID Connect Code flow with PKCE. This is good solution when implementing SPA apps requesting data from APIs on separate domains. OpenID Connect back-channel logout using Azure Redis Cache and IdentityServer4

This article shows how to implement an OpenID Connect back-channel logout, which uses Azure Redis cache so that the session logout will work with multi instance deployments. Implementing User Management with ASP.NET Core Identity and custom claims

The article shows how to implement user management for an ASP.NET Core application using ASP.NET Core Identity. The application uses custom claims, which need to be added to the user identity after a successful login, and then an ASP.NET Core policy is used to authorize the identity.
